Amazon.com Product Description
The Oyster docking station from Sherpaq Mobile Products enhances portable computing by simplifying laptop docking, improving comfort, and managing cable clutter. While traditional docking stations connect the laptop to peripherals such as a desktop monitor, the Oyster repositions a laptop so that it it's perpendicular to your desk and thereby better positioned for comfortable viewing of laptop's very own LCD screen. The Oyster also offers a handy four-port, high-speed USB 2.0 hub--a real improvement over the many minimalist docking stations out there.

The Oyster's slim profile and tidy cable-management system not only look nice, they conserve space, too, leaving sufficient real estate for your full-size keyboard. The station conceals all cables associated with Internet access, power, printing, and keyboard use in its rear storage bay. For use, simply open your laptop, slide it into the Oyster, and connect your power and USB cables.

If you have an extra laptop power supply, you may want it inside the Oyster's protective shell. Wireless transceivers will also fit nicely. It has posts for wrapping your cables around. The USB hub comes with two extension cables in case you want to connect devices outside the Oyster.

The Oyster was built to accommodate most laptop designs, both PC and Apple. There are very few laptops which won't work with the Oyster, but keep in mind that it's necessary for your laptop's monitor to open approximately 170 degrees to ensure optimal viewing. The following computers do not meet this specification: Toshiba Satellite 2430, Toshiba 5005-S507, Compaq Presario 1200, the white/"ice" iBook (the older "clamshell" iBooks are compatible), and the 17-inch Powerbook G4 (though the 15-inch Powerbook G4 and G3 series are compatible).

The slot into which you slide your laptop is slightly larger than 1.5 inches, so in order to use the Oyster your computer body's height from base to top (not including the screen) should measure something less than 1.5 inches.

The Oyster comes with an AC power adapter for situations where multiple USB devices which don't have their own power are connected to the hub. If additional USB devices pull too much power from the computer, one or more of your peripherals may stop working. This will not harm your peripherals. If this happens or if you'll be using more than three non-USB-powered peripherals, insert the supplied AC adapter into the right side of the USB hub, pull the cable through one of the cable slots located at the base of the Oyster, and connect the cable to a power source.

What's in the Box
Oyster base unit with USB hub, outer shell, rubber cable guide, two USB extension cables, Velcro straps, AC power adapter, and user's manual.

5 out of 5 stars A great idea   August 8, 2003
Russ Blahetka
6 out of 7 found this review helpful

This is one of those products where you smack your forehead and ask, "Why didn't I think of that?" It's such a simple concept, and the implementation is elegant. I use my laptop as my office system and I have very little desktop real estate. Also, I prefer using a full size keyboard. Unfortunately, using a full size keyboard would mean pushing the laptop even further away, causing even more crouching and squinting to read the screen. The Oyster moves the screen up to normal monitor height where the screen is easier to see. Further, I can organize the cables so I no longer need to worry about them falling behind my desk. Having access to a full size keyboard makes my work easier, faster, and I have less eyestrain and neck pain.
